Monument record TQ 76 NE 706 - Romano-British lead coffin, near St. Mary's Church, Frindsbury Extra

Summary

A Romano-British lead coffin, reportedly found in 1838 opposite St. Mary's Church, Chatham. It was ornamented with cockle shells and a 'large cross' and a pottery vessel was found within it. Summary from record TQ 76 NE 46: Romano-British lead coffin found at St. Mary's Church, Chatham in c.1838. Present whereabouts and further details are uncertain.

Full Description

In 1838 a brief account was given, (a), of the discovery some time previously of a Roman lead coffin 'at the distance of about 16' (from the surface ?), in the chalky cliff opposite St. Mary's Church, Chatham.' In it was a pottery vessel c. 7" high. Some other like discoveries are believed to have been madeat that time. (1) Found while labourers were digging a chalk pit, at a depth of c. 16'. The coffin had "a cross upon the side, and a number of figures indented, resembling large cockle shells" and the pot contained liquid. The whole was unfortunately broken. (2) Found a little to the south of the Roman house [TQ76NW16]. It was ornamented with cockle shells and a 'large cross' (probably the crossed billet moulding pattern). (3) Add. ref. (4) No information as to the exact provenance or present whereabouts of the lead coffin was gained during field work. (5)
